Increasing the Clarity of Pie Chart Labels | Tableau Software Select the color button on the Marks card. Move the slider to the left until the labels become clear. Option 3: Manually drag the labels off of the pie charts. Select the Mark (slice of the pie) for the label that will be moved. Click and hold the text label for mark. Drag the label to desired location. Additional Information How to Create a Tableau Pie Chart? 7 Easy Steps The Tableau Pie Chart seen in the screenshot below is the result of the above stages. Tableau Pie Chart - Tutorial Gateway To create Tableau pie charts, first, Drag the Sales Measures to the Columns shelf. Since it is a Measure value, the Sales Amount will aggregate to a Sum (default). Next, Drag and Drop the English Country Region Name from Dimension Region to Rows Card. Once you drag them, the following bar chart screenshot will be displayed.

Understanding and using Pie Charts | Tableau Pie Chart Best Practices: Each pie slice should be labeled appropriately, with the right number or percentage attached to the corresponding slice. The slices should be ordered by size, either from biggest to smallest or smallest to biggest to make the comparison of slices easy for the user. Calculate Percentages in Tableau - Tableau To calculate percentages in your visualization: Select Analysis > Percentages Of, and then select a percentage option. Percentage options Computing a percentage involves specifying a total on which the percentage is based. The default percentage calculation is based on the entire table. You can also choose a different option.

Thank you! tableau-api Share Show, Hide, and Format Mark Labels - Tableau On the Marks card, click Label. In the dialog box that opens, under Marks to Label, select one of the following options: All Label all marks in the view. Min/Max Label only the minimum and maximum values for a field in the view. When you select this option, you must specify a scope and field to label by.

How to represent values in pie chart as percentage of total? Right-click on Count of Users and select Quick Table Calculation > Percent of Total. Click on Label on the Marks card and select Show mark labels. Create new measure field and use that field to highlight your data in pie chart. How you will create that field, divide individual value by total sum of values of that perticular column. Tableau Playbook - Pie Chart | Pluralsight Specifically, in Tableau, a pie chart is used to show proportion or percentage values across the dimension. To create a pie chart, we need one dimension and a measure. Tableau supports another measure displayed as Size to compare in a group of pie marks, but this usage is not recommended. Dynamic Exterior Pie Chart Labels with Arrows/lines - Tableau Answer As a workaround, use Annotations: Select an individual pie chart slice (or all slices). Right-click the pie, and click on Annotate > Mark. Edit the dialog box that pops up as needed to show the desired fields, then click OK. Drag the annotations to the desired locations in the view. Ctrl + click to select all the annotation text boxes. Pie Chart in Tableau | Learn Useful Steps To ... - EDUCBA Introduction to Pie Chart in Tableau. The shares are essentially percentage shares in total contribution. Build a Pie Chart - Tableau Add labels by dragging the Sub-Category dimension from the Data pane to Label on the Marks card. If you don't see labels, press Ctrl + Shift + B (press ñ + z + B on a Mac) to make sure most of the individual labels are visible. You can make a pie chart interactive in a dashboard. For more information, see Actions and Dashboards.
